Huntington Coast Capital negotiated and procured a $1,500,000 credit line for a wireless service provider in Irvine, CA. The company was outgrowing their bank’s ability to fund their projects. The nature of their product required contracts for service over an extended period of time, and often were in the multi-million dollar range. The contracts required capital prior to delivery to cover cost of goods and other fixed expenses. This made a traditional accounts receivable line of credit challenging because most lenders lend on accounts receivable after services have been delivered.

They spoke to a number of community banks and finance companies and none seemed to deliver the amount of capital (at the right price) for their needs. Enter Huntington Coast Capital. After our initial consultation, we introduced a couple of avenues and potential lending sources for them to choose from. We introduced a factoring company and a couple of creative asset based lenders for them to consider. After the proposals were received, HCC highlighted the differences in the funding options and ran the cost through our pricing model matrix to offer a side by side comparison.

The company made their choice and are now able to meet the demand of their pending contracts and grow the company significantly.

Huntington Coast Capital is proud to announce the closing of a $840,000 SBA loan for a sauna manufacturer in San Francisco! The company was looking to re-structure some debt and utilize some outside capital for expansion.

The company was referred to us by one of our lending partners who could not offer them a term loan. Because they sold their product directly to consumers and not through retail distribution, they did not have accounts receivable. Non-SBA lenders need to have accounts receivable and/or inventory to provide working capital lines of credit. The SBA lenders look at things a bit differently; they look at the cash flow and debt service ability of the company. The company had strong cash flow and was trending in a growth direction.

Huntington Coast Capital secured a $2,300,000 line of credit for working capital and equipment needs for a rapidly growing glass fabricator in California.

The company, established in 2009, offers full service glass fabrication out of their 80,000 square foot, state of the art facility. Their product offering includes architectural and creative glass fabrication services for office, industrial, retail and residential uses.

They were referred to us by a local bank that required a lock box arrangement which the borrower was not able to oblige. After our initial consultation, we directed them to a select group of three lenders to discuss their financing needs and preferences. In the end, they selected a lender that was able to provide the equipment loan (with lower fees than the SBA product) and working capital needs without the use of a lock box. The borrower now deposits his collected checks from customers into his bank account that the lender sweeps to repay the loan balance.

The entire process from introductions to funding took under 35 days! Now the company can meet demand and grow with their lender. Another example of how Huntington Coast Capital takes the headache out of finding the best lender for your business.
